Genetic deletion of CB2 does not affect the normal development or immune homeostasis of the lung. (A to C) Normal lung development with the CB2 deletion. (A) Gross appearance of the lung tissues (left lobe) of adult CB2 −/− and control CB2 +/+ littermates. (B) Tissue weights (left lobe) were measured. n = 6, mean ± SEM, n.s., not significant (Student's t -test). (C) Representative images of the lung tissue sections of CB2 +/+ and CB2 −/− mice assessed by hematoxylin and eosin (H&E) staining. (D) The CB2 deletion does not affect tissue levels of the endocannabinoid 2-AG. 2-AG tissue levels in the lungs of CB2 +/+ and CB2 −/− mice were compared by the ELISA analysis. n = 6, mean ± SEM, n.s., not significant (Student's t -test). (E and F) Immune cell populations are not affected by the CB2 deletion. (E) ILC2s and other immune cell types in the lungs of CB2 +/+ and CB2 −/− mice were examined by the FACS analysis. n = 5, mean ± SEM, n.s., not significant (Student's t -test). (F) Representative FACS gating of eosinophils (CD45 + CD11b + CD11c − Siglec-F + ) and alveolar macrophages (CD45 + CD11b + CD11c + Siglec-F + ) in the lung.

Genetic deletion of CB2 mitigates the IL-33-elicited type 2 immunity in the lung. (A and B) Wild-type mice were intranasally treated with IL-33 or control saline. (A) ILC2s were FACS-sorted from the saline-treated or IL-33-treated lung tissues, and CB2 mRNA levels in ILC2s were compared by the qPCR analysis. n = 3, mean ± SEM, n.s., not significant (Student's t -test). (B) 2-AG levels in the saline-treated or IL-33-treated lung tissues were quantified by the ELISA analysis. n ​= ​4, mean ​± ​SEM, ∗ p < 0.05 (Student's t -test). (C to K) CB2 −/− and control CB2 +/+ littermates were subjected to intranasal IL-33 treatment. (C) ILC2s in the IL-33-treated lungs of CB2 +/+ and CB2 −/− mice were examined by the FACS analysis. n = 7, mean ± SEM, n.s., not significant (Student's t -test). (D) mRNA levels of IL-4 , IL-5 , and IL-13 in the lung tissues of CB2 +/+ and CB2 −/− mice were determined by the qPCR analysis and normalized to the saline-treated CB2 +/+ condition. n ​= ​5 for saline-treated condition and n ​= ​15 for IL-33-treated condition, mean ​± ​SEM, ∗ p < 0.05 (two-way ANOVA test). (E) Protein levels of IL-5 and IL-13 in the IL-33-treated lungs of CB2 +/+ and CB2 −/− mice were quantified by the ELISA analysis. n ​= ​3, mean ​± ​SEM, ∗ p < 0.05 (Student's t -test). (F and G) IL-33-elicited immune response in the lung was visualized by advanced 3D imaging. The intact, unsectioned lungs (left lobe) of CB2 +/+ and CB2 −/− mice were processed for the whole-tissue anti-Siglec-F immunolabeling. (F) Representative 3D-projection images at 1.26 × magnification of the lightsheet imaging were shown. (G) The density of Siglec-F + immune cells was quantified. n ​= ​5, mean ​± ​SEM, ∗ p < 0.05 (two-way ANOVA test). (H and I) Eosinophil recruitment in the lungs of CB2 +/+ and CB2 −/− mice was assessed by the FACS analysis. (H) Representative FACS gating of eosinophils (CD45 + CD11b + CD11c − Siglec-F + ) in the IL-33-treated condition. (I) The percentage of eosinophils in total immune cells was quantified. n ​= ​5 for saline-treated condition and n ​= ​12 for IL-33-treated condition, mean ​± ​SEM, ∗ p < 0.05 (two-way ANOVA test). (J and K) The lung tissues of CB2 +/+ and CB2 −/− mice were assessed by hematoxylin and eosin (H&E) staining. (J) Representative images were shown. (K) Histologic scores were determined. n ​= ​5 for saline-treated condition and n ​= ​7 for IL-33-treated condition, mean ​± ​SEM, ∗ p < 0.05 (two-way ANOVA test).
